Simple and elegant

I'm so glad I bought this - I just wish I had done it sooner! I'm working on a project that has several printouts and folders that need to be kept. I got by with a longer punch with three holes and a lever for many years. It only punched 20 sheets and took up more space, and the smoke catcher kept falling off, spreading fumes all over the floor. The Carl 63040 punches much easier and better than my old one and takes up less space on the small shelf I have to keep it on. The paper instructions are the best I've seen. The locking mechanism is simple: you lock the handle by flipping a small hook on the back instead of maneuvering the lever into the locked position. I initially had trouble opening the Chad trap from below because the bottom looks solid and there were no instructions on how to open it. It took me a while to figure out that it just detaches from the two tabs on the outer edge of the punch (to get it back just slide it back into the tabs and close like you would the battery compartment of a TV remote control or another close kitchen clock). I blame the company for not providing the buyer with a sticker explaining how to do this, but I'm still very happy with my purchase. Definitely deserves 5 stars.
